The interview process was very relaxed and started with a get-to-know-you in the president's office. I first met with the HR manager, who conducted a brief introduction to the company and explained the details of the Project Manager role. Next, the HR Manager asked basic questions about my background and asked me to provide examples of past experiences. Later, I met with the hiring manager, who gave me a tour of the facility and brought me back to the president's office for further interviewing and examination. Examination included a personality test and a short competency exam. The meeting concluded with the introduction of the director of the area that I had applied for. The director then asked a few brief questions about my goals and what I expected from the role. Overall, it was a fantastic interview experience.
